missing mass

–noun Astrophysics.
the difference in mass in the universe between that observed to exist and that necessary for the closed universe model.

Origin:
1975–80

missing mass  
n.  
  1. The mass needed to account for the difference between the observed mass of the universe and the mass needed to halt the expansion of the universe.

  2. The unobserved matter needed for the observed rotation of most galaxies to match theoretical predictions.
